Botanical name : Helianthus annus Linn
Family : Asteraceae
SANSKRIT SYNONYMS
Adityabhakta, Sooryamukhi, Suryamukhi
AYURVEDIC PROPERTIES
Rasa    : Tikta, Katu, Kashaya    
Guna   : Lakhu, Snigdha
Virya   : Ushna
PLANT NAME IN DIFFERENT LANGUAGES
English     :     Common sunflower
Hindi        :     Surajmukhi
Malayalam    :     Soorykanthi
Distribution : Cultivated in many parts of India
PLANT DESCRIPTION
An erect annual herb grows up to 4 m in height. stem hirsute and few branches at the lop; leaves simple, alternate, long-stalked, broadly ovate to cordate, toothed, rough pubescent on both sides; flowers bright yellow, in heads, terminal on the main axis and branches; fruits slightly compressed cypsela.
MEDICINAL PROPERTIES
The plant pacifies vitiated kapha, vata, The roots are for strengthening the teeth. The leaves are useful in low back pain, fever, ulcers, wounds, head ache and burning sensation. The flowers are useful in inflammations, skin diseases, pruritus, ulcers, hysteria, bronchitis, asthma, anemia, burning sensation, hemorrhoids, ascites, worm infestations, intermittent fevers, amenorrhea, dysmenorrheal. The seeds are expectorant and diuretic, and are useful in cough and pneumonia.  
Useful part    :    Roots, Leaves, Flowers, Seeds
